NEW YORK Standard and Poor’s launched a corporate campaign in The Wall Street Journal today, a move the client said was a response to the stock market’s recent “volatility and upheaval.”

Ten print executions from Della Femina Rothschild Jeary in New York aim to portray surefooted chief officers who do their homework with Standard and Poor’s. The work is tagged, “Your confidence is showing. You’ve got Standard and Poor’s.”

One ad shows an executive standing on the steps of the New York Stock Exchange, smiling confidently with his hands in his pockets.
